Veteran's Day Parade
Warriors at Home had a great day today! We started out walking in the Veteran's Day Parade. It was frrrrrrreezing cold, but we were very proud to represent our troops!


After the parade and a nice lunch, we went to the Apple Glen Walmart where we had a "fill-the-boot" drive to raise funds for the Welcome Home. We received $352.42 in donations in those stinky old combat boots in just over 2 hours! We We also handed out fliers for our upcoming Chik-Fil-A and Scrapbook Extravaganza Fundraisers.

Charity Stockings
Saturday, December 6, 6:30PM
Phone:
(260) 494-2393
We would like to invite you and your guests to our fifth annual holiday charity stocking party on Saturday, December 6, 2008. For those who haven't attended in the past, we provide all the party food, drinks, blackmail photos, and material to sew a hand-made stocking. (Yes, grown men can sew!!) You provide the manpower to create a stocking, and the toys for stuffing the stocking. Many small gifts for a child 6-10 yrs. are great. For example, baseball cards, matchbox cars, Barbie dolls, barrettes, playing cards, school supplies, just to name a few. We don't want to forget the active duty military this year, so also bring some items to make a second stocking for a local person serving oversees. For example dried fruits/nuts, gum, hard candy, wet wipes, socks, stationery w/ envelopes, CD's, playing cards, dice, dominoes, phone cards, sodoku books, etc. We will donate all the finished children's stockings to locals in need.
We will donate all the finished military stockings to "Warriors at Home" and "Blue Star Mothers" groups supporting the locally deployed soldiers of Fort Wayne. The partying will begin around 6pm, and the sewing should commence sometime thereafter. The party will last as long as your fingers do! This is a great time to get together before the holidays, and to provide a worthwhile donation to a local charity and help support our armed forces overseas. Feel free to bring your children to participate. If you are unable to attend, but are interested in donating please RSVP and Jason will respond to make arrangements. Our home is located in a development in Roanoke.
